COLLECTION
Since the 1979s the WBA-MDD is collecting objects with design-historic significance as well as archive material and objects to document modern everyday life characterized by commodity culture. Presently the museum has a relevant collection of about 25.000 objects. At a former factory building the museum presents itself in the fashion of an open depot, offering to its visitors an area of more than 500 m˛ to explore directly the museums practise in dealing with the collections. The objects are combined in model collections, illustrating for one thing the basics of Werkbund aims, for another thing common aspects of the material, functional, formal and utilitarian history of the things in the 20th century and contemporary product culture. The exhibits are contrasted in combinations full of potential: objects of well-known designers and anonymous creations, functional, puristic objects and so called “taste aberrations” or “Kitsch”, substantial “honest” objects and surrogate materials, trademark and no-name products.
